International Association of Scientific Philosophy:
"Many people think that philosophy is inseparable of speculation. They believe that philosophers cannot use methods that establish the knowledge, the knowledge of facts or of logical relations, and that he must speak a language not verifiable; in short that the philosophy is not a science. I try to establish the opposite thesis. I hold that the philosophical speculation is a temporary phase. To say it briefly: I have the intention to demonstrate that the philosophy started with speculation to arrive to science".
"The scientific philosophy tries to come to conclusions as precise and as sure as the results of the science. It insists that the problem of the truth must appear inside the philosophy in the same sense that in the sciences. It does not try to possess an absolute truth, which existence it denies for the empirical knowledge. The new philosophy is in itself empirical and is satisfied with the empirical truth".
Hans Reichenbach, Rise oh the Scientific Philosophy
